Transaction 66967566f5507bb9ee464e1504de6619d26da865ccc64a6139c2547c6e1cde96
1 Input
1 Output
-
66967566f5507bb9ee464e1504de6619d26da865ccc64a6139c2547c6e1cde96:0
- value
- 22773424
- script pubkey
- OP_0 OP_PUSHBYTES_20 fbb0de335ea9aea825786f0023091cb1f706d483
- address
- bc1qlwcduv674xh2sftcduqzxzguk8msd4yrqz7xpn